> From: "Wintemute, Robert" > Date: June 28, 2013, 10:26:17 PM GMT+05:30 > Subject: International Commission of Jurists: 2 new SO/GI databases > > http://www.icj.org/icj-launches-two-innovative-legal-databases/ > > ICJ launches two innovative legal databases > Today the ICJ launches two new innovative legal tools: the Sexual Orientation > & Gender Identity UN Database and the Sexual Orientation & Gender Identity > Legislative Database. > The UN Database gathers all the SOGI-related doctrine and jurisprudence of > the UN human rights system in one searchable database. > It is the electronic version of the UN Compilations, which the ICJ has issued > regularly since 2005. > The documents are organized by source (such as treaty body, special > rapporteur or working group) and it is possible to search the database by > source or by country, region or key word. > The Legislative Database is the result of a year-long pilot project in > collaboration with the International Human Rights Program at the University > of Toronto Faculty of Law. > Student researchers gathered and analyzed laws from twenty-four countries in > all regions of the world. Each country is introduced with a legislative > overview. > The laws themselves are LGBT-friendly or neutral with regard to sexual > orientation and gender identity. It is searchable by country and topic. > The purpose was to provide the actual texts of laws as comparative examples > for use in legislative reform efforts. > The ICJ is very pleased to announce the launch of these new resources to help > activists and lawyers around the world advocate for LGBT human rights. > Both databases were created by HURIDOCS. > The hard copy version of the 2013 edition of the UN Compilation can be > downloaded below: > SOGI UN Compilation electronic version – publications-2013 (full text in pdf) >
